    The Washington Monument syndrome, [1] also known as the Mount Rushmore syndrome [2] or the firemen first principle, [3] [4] is a term used to describe the phenomenon of government agencies in the United States cutting the most visible or appreciated service provided by the government when faced with budget cuts.
